Power comparisons of shapirowilk, kolmogorovsmirnov. This figure is very similar to figure 3 of kolmogorovsmirnov test for normality. A normal probability plot of the sample data will be created in excel. Excel normality tests kolmogorovsmirnov, andersondarling, shapiro wilk tests for 2sample unpooled ttest. Confirm the test decision by visually comparing the empirical cumulative distribution function cdf to the standard normal cdf. The kolmogorovsmirnov test suppose that we have observations x 1x n, which we think come from a distribution p. The test statistic in the kolmogorovsmirnov test is very easy, it is just the maximum vertical distance between the empirical cumulative distribution functions of the two samples. Test for distributional adequacy, the kolmogorovsmirnov test chakravart. Small sample power of tests of normality when the alternative. The ks test has reasonable power against a range of alternative hypotheses. Lilliefors the george washington university the standard tables used for the kolmogorovsmirnov test are valid when testing whether a set of observations are from a completely specified continuous distribution. Note that the distribution of the teststatistic itself is no longer distributionfree but a permutationtest avoids that issue. Kolmogorov smirnov in works with smaller sam ple sizes and estimation of parameters from the sample data makes the test more conservative unfortunately the test requires special tables or calculations exceptunfortunately, the test requires special tables or calculations except when being used to test for the exponential or uniform.
Kolmogorovsmirnov tests have the advantages that a the distribution of statistic does not depend on cumulative distribution function being tested and b the test is exact. Key facts about the kolmogorovsmirnov test graphpad prism. Small sample power of tests of normality when the alternative is an. Shapirowilk sw test, kolmogorovsmirnov ks test, lillieors lf test and andersondarling ad test. Create a vector containing the first column of the exam grade data. First of all select to test for a uniform distribution ua,b with a 0 and b 2 to get the following results. For the data in my previous article, the null hypothesis is that the sample data follow a n59, 5 distribution. Note that the distribution of the test statistic itself is no longer distribution free but a permutation test avoids that issue. They have the disadvantage that they are more sensitive to deviations near the centre of the distribution than at the tails. This paper compares the power of four formal tests of normality. Goodnessoffit test the distribution of the kolmogorovsmirnov.
If the kolmogorovsmirnov test does reject the null hypothesis, the qq graph of the quantiles provide useful insights in to the nature of. The onesample kolmogorovsmirnov test procedure compares the observed cumulative distribution function for a variable with a specified theoretical distribution, which may be normal, uniform, poisson, or exponential. We use the excel function expondist to calculate the exponential distribution valued fx in column f. Excel normality tests kolmogorovsmirnov, andersondarling. Therefore, we can use a beta distribution to find the practical pvalue of a goodnessoffit test, which is much simpler than existing methods in the literature. The kolmogorovsmirnov ks statistical test is commonly used to determine if data can be regarded as a sample from a sequence of independent and identically distributed i. On the kolmogorovsmirnov test for the exponential distribution. Test for distributional adequacy the andersondarling test stephens, 1974 is used to test if a sample of data came from a population with a specific distribution. Title lillieforscorrected kolmogorovsmirnov goodnessoffit tests. Kiefer, ksample analogues of the kolmogorov smirnov and cramer. Distribution theory for tests based on the sample distribution function. In statistics, the kolmogorovsmirnov test ks test or ks test is a nonparametric test of the equality of continuous, onedimensional probability distributions that can be used to compare a sample with a reference probability distribution onesample ks test, or.
You can use simulation to estimate the critical value for the kolmogorov smirnov statistical test for normality, which is sometimes abbreviated as the ks test. Kolmogorovsmirnov test principles influentialpoints. In the current implementation of the kolmogorovsmirnov test, a sample is compared with a normal distribution where the sample mean and the sample variance are used as parameters of the distribution. Whitney, on a test of whether one of two random variables is stochastically larger than the other, a nn. The distribution of kolmogorovsmirnov statistic can be globally approximated by a general beta distribution. The kolmogorovsmirnov z is computed from the largest difference in absolute value between the observed and theoretical.
The kolmogorovsmirnov statistic quantifies a distance between the empirical distribution function of the sample and the cumulative distribution function of the reference distribution. Tests based on the empirical distribution function sas support. A goodness of fit test for the exponential distribution. We then plot the values of the cumulative distribution function of the uniform density defined as b k k. Pdf the distribution of the kolmogorovsmirnov, cramer. The mww test is more powerful when h1 is the location shift. December 8, 2006 abstract this paper is a montecarlo study of the small sample power of six tests of a normality hypotheses when the alternative is an. In statistics, the kolmogorovsmirnov test ks test or ks test is a nonparametric test of the equality of continuous or discontinuous, see section 2. Alternatively, y can be an ecdf function or an object of class stepfun for specifying a discrete. The kolmogorov smirnov test suppose that we have observations x 1x n, which we think come from a distribution p. The standard tables used for the kolmogorovsmirnov test are valid when testing. It uses monte carlo simulation to estimate pvalues. In general, we use the kolmogorov smirnov test to compare a data set to a given theoretical distribution by filling in a table as follows.
The kolmogorov smirnov ks test is used in over 500 refereed papers each year in the astronomical literature. The distribution of the kolmogorovsmirnov, cramervon mises, and andersondarling test statistics for exponential populations with estimated parameters. If the number n of draws is large, then the empirical distribution p. One sample kolmogorovsmirnov test real statistics using excel. Kolmogorovsmirnov table real statistics using excel.
Perform the onesample kolmogorovsmirnov test by using kstest. The following five normality tests will be performed on the sample data here. The kolmogorovsmirnov ks statistical test is commonly used to determine if. Justification and extension of doobs heuristic approach to the kolmogorov smirnov theorems donsker, monroe d. One sample kolmogorovsmirnov test real statistics using. The ks test is distribution free in the sense that the critical.
B18 of figure 1 is distributed significantly different from an exponential distribution. Lilliefors the george washington university the standard tables used for the kolmogorov smirnov test are valid when testing whether a set of observations are from a completely specified continuous distribution. In statistics, the kolmogorov smirnov test ks test or ks test is a nonparametric test of the equality of continuous or discontinuous, see section 2. The kolmogorovsmirnov ks test is used in over 500 refereed papers each year in the astronomical literature. Simulation has been the primary tool for studying these statistics.
Pdf a goodness of fit test for the exponential distribution. This is the probability of obtaining x marked items when randomly drawing a sample of size n without replacement from a population of total size t containing m marked items. Kolmogorovsmirnov an overview sciencedirect topics. The standard tables used for the kolmogorovsmirnov test are valid when testing whether a set of observations are. The kolmogorovsmirnov test is designed to test the hypothesis that a given data set. Pdf the distribution of the kolmogorovsmirnov, cramervon. Tests based on the empirical distribution function. Perform the onesample kolmogorov smirnov test by using kstest. Density, distribution function, quantile function and random generation for. It does not assume that data are sampled from gaussian distributions or any other defined distributions. The kolmogorovsmirnov ks test is based on the empirical distribution function.
The kolmogorov smirnov statistic quantifies a distance between the empirical distribution function of the sample and the cumulative distribution function cdf of the reference distribution 3,4,5,6, 7. To test the hypothesis, the two cumulative distribution functions cdfs are compared, that is the empirical and theoretical distribution function. It compares the cumulative distribution function for a variable with a specified distribution. The empirical cumulative distribution of a sample is the proportion of the sample values that are less than or equal to a given value. Performs one or two sample kolmogorovsmirnov tests.
Figure 1 kolmogorovsmirnov test for exponential distribution. Pages 295301 onesample kolmogorov test, 309314 twosample smirnov test. So sometimes its okay to use the standard tables even with discrete distributions, and even when its not okay, its not so much the test statistic. Key facts about the kolmogorovsmirnov test the two sample kolmogorovsmirnov test is a nonparametric test that compares the cumulative distributions of two data sets1,2. We generated 1,000 random numbers for normal, double exponential, t with 3 degrees of freedom, and lognormal distributions. The kolmogorovsmirnov test is not very powerful, and the power is hard to estimate, but see birnbaum 6 for some lower bounds. George marsaglia, wai wan tsang and jingbo wang 2003. The kolmogorovsmirnov statistic for a given cumulative distribution function fx is. Pdf we propose a new test statistic which is a modification of the shapiro wilk w statistic for testing goodness of fit for the exponential. The onesample kolmogorovsmirnov test is used to test whether a sample comes from a specific distribution.
This given distribution is usually not always the normal distribution, hence kolmogorovsmirnov normality test. The standard tables used for the kolmogorov smirnov test are valid when testing whether a set of observations are. However, when the actual underlying distribution of the draws di. The use of this test is discussed in conovers practical nonparametric statistics. Spss kolmogorovsmirnov test for normality the ultimate guide. In statistics, the kolmogorovsmirnov test ks test or ks test is a nonparametric test of the equality of continuous, onedimensional probability distributions that can be used to compare a sample with a reference probability distribution onesample ks test, or to compare two samples twosample ks test. The kolmogorovsmirnov ks goodnessoffit test compares a hypothetical or. If the kolmogorovsmirnov test does reject the null hypothesis, the qq graph of the quantiles provide useful insights in to the nature of the data generating process behind the data. An excel histogram of the sample data will be created.
So sometimes its okay to use the standard tables even with discrete distributions, and even when its not okay, its not so much the test statistic as the critical valuespvalues you use with it thats the issue. In all cases, the kolmogorovsmirnov test was applied to test for a normal distribution. The onesample kolmogorov smirnov test procedure compares the observed cumulative distribution function for a variable with a specified theoretical distribution, which may be normal, uniform, poisson, or exponential. This test is used as a test of goodness of fit and is ideal when the size of the sample is small. How do i check if my data fits an exponential distribution.
Nov 22, 2017 the kolmogorovsmirnov test ks test is a bit more complex and allows you to detect patterns you cant detect with a students ttest. The power of alternative kolmogorovsmirnov tests based on. The test statistic then approximates the chisquare distribution with ks1 degrees of freedom, where. It is a nonparametric hypothesis test that measures the probability that a chosen univariate dataset is drawn from the same parent population as a second dataset the twosample ks test or a continuous model the onesample ks test. Compute the probability density function pdf at x of the hypergeometric distribution with parameters t, m, and n. This test is used in situations where a comparison has to be made between an observed sample distribution and theoretical distribution. This test pet 77 checks that the distribution of a set of samples conforms to the theoretical distribution. The kolmogorovsmirnov statistic quantifies a distance between the empirical distribution function of the sample and the cumulative distribution function cdf of the reference distribution 3,4,5,6, 7.
May 20, 2019 critical values of the kolmogorov d distribution. It is a modification of the kolmogorov smirnov ks test and gives more weight to the tails than does the ks test. Kolmogorovsmirnov in works with smaller sam ple sizes and estimation of parameters from the sample data makes the test more conservative unfortunately the test requires special tables or calculations exceptunfortunately, the test requires special tables or calculations except when being used to test for the exponential or uniform. Some distributionfree tests for the difference between two empirical cumulative distribution functions drion, e. An investigation of the kolmogorovsmirnov nonparametric test.
Critical values of the kolmogorovsmirnov test the do loop. An investigation of the kolmogorovsmirnov nonparametric. In statistics, the kolmogorovsmirnov test is a nonparametric test of the equality of continuous. The kolmogorov smirnov z is computed from the largest difference in absolute value between the observed and theoretical. Our investigation of the ks test will focus on the two sample twosided version. In this paper we propose an improvement of the kolmogorovsmirnov test for normality. If you specify the edf option, proc npar1way computes tests based on the empirical distribution function.
The statistics may also be used for tests for the weibull distribution. The test statistic in the kolmogorov smirnov test is very easy, it is just the maximum vertical distance between the empirical cumulative distribution functions of the two samples. We can use this procedure to determine whether a sample comes from a population which is normally distributed see kolmogorov smirnov test for normality we now show how to modify the procedure to test whether a sample comes from an exponential distribution. Notes the kolmogorovsmirnov ks twosample test is an alternative to the mww test. The distribution of the kolmogorov smirnov, cramervon mises, and andersondarling test statistics for exponential populations with estimated parameters. To construct the kolmogorovsmirnov test we first order the. Lcks lillieforscorrected kolmogorovsmirnov goodnessoffit test description implements the lillieforscorrected kolmogorovsmirnov test for use in goodnessof. In general, we use the kolmogorovsmirnov test to compare a data set to a given theoretical distribution by filling in a table as follows. These include the kolmogorovsmirnov and cramervon mises tests, and also the kuiper test for twosample data. On the kolmogorovsmirnov test for the exponential distribution with mean unknown.
680 1466 1182 1536 1322 494 207 1499 1553 589 1218 1127 1247 1280 1376 1480 1019 962 473 1387 580 323 321 995 996 782 1215 203 605 273 733 1418 1326 1273 1186 499 1144 66